Beauty of the Right Kind of Artwork
All through my years of experience as a Professional Interior Decorator and no matter my Client's budget, I always sort for the right kind of artwork to match the Interior I am designing. The ability to choose the right size, right colour, right theme to give the perfect emotion that suits an interior space is important. The emotion that a piece of artwork radiates is important or you don't bother fixing one on the wall at all. There is a story behind every piece of art. Identify it first before you use it.
I personally believe no interior is perfect without the right kind of wall fixes. You know I personally generalise the meaning of Artwork.
Artwork could be something painted or designed, either by hand or by any piece of technology necessary. Helps beautify the walls, made up of flat surface, can be hung and that's designed creativity or should I say designed with creative thinking. Art has broadened. It cannot be limited to something made out of canvases or wood or made out of pencil or oil paints and brush anymore. Just like life keeps evolving, art has evolved also.

So not to digress too much, the ability to know what nature of art piece to use and the right kind of impression you want to create is very important. To me as a decorator, all art forms are priceless, very priceless. It could be the most affordable piece of creative art you find that would have the right type of message for a very luxurious Interior. Thus, that makes it priceless.
During one of my leisure times, I was seeing a movie then I noticed a board sized wall picture frame of a segment to the face of an elephant and then that of a Rhino. It was used to decorate a wall. These frames were placed side by side on the wall. Pictures of the animals were taken in their natural state/form. Pictures were capture moment when the animals were standing upright, eyes opened and head straight to give the perfect outlook. The picture frames were paired side by side, made to sit pretty on a royal blue wall and I was dazzled. The natural state of those animal was in it's grey state so the colour contracts to the wall was perfect. You needed to have seen how wonderful and unique it came out. It looked amazingly gorgeous. That was somebody's creative idea to what a piece of art should be. My ideas to these things has deepened. I tell you, being a designer is all about creatively thinking outside the box. There are no rules or regulations. It's all about doing something that is pleasing to the eyes, acceptable, reasonable, sensible, passionate and that can be appreciated. To me a Rhino and an Elephant signifies power and wealth. That's why people steal some essential parts of their body. And without those parts, these animals are deemed powerless, smiles.

We Decorators have realised that you don't leave a wall vacant when completing an Interior decoration. You must plan the wall as you are planning for the other things. Every piece of decoration you use in a house must have a connection. Walls are important parts to an Interior and people notice your wall first before sitting down to appreciate your pieces of furniture plus every other thing inside.
